My Music DNA: Singer/Songwriter, Lucy Spraggan

No stranger to the spotlight, Sheffield -born singer/songwriter Lucy Spraggan was the first X-Factor contestant to have a Top 40 single and an album before the live shows began in 2012 and went on to have 5 Top 30 albums and to be the first female headliner of Kendall Calling Festival.

With a big Summer of festival bookings scheduled and lost for 2020, Lucy took the changes the pandemic wrought in her stride and focused on completing her latest album and launching her fitness brand.

Lucy starts 2021 with the release of her latest single, Animal from her brand new album Choices due for release on February 26th, inspired by a rich tapestry of  life experiences, that have served in giving her the head space to mature and grow, both musically and personally.

Here, Lucy reveals her Music DNA to Andy Howells.

What was the first song that made an impact on you?

My United States of Whatever – Liam Lynch. Awful song, but I know every word for some reason.

What was the first single you bought?

I have no idea! I don’t remember downloading a song for the first time, but I do remember my first album!

So, what was the first album you owned?

Americana – The Offspring

What’s your constant go to track?

Deniro – J LOpez

What’s your constant go to album?

Lumineers – self titled

Who’s your latest music discovery?

I absolutely love The Dunwells. I’ve written lots of songs with those guys – I think they are amazing.

What’s your own track that best defines you as an artist?

From the new record, it’s got to be Choices. The defining line being “dont be afraid of being you”

What’s the track that best defines you as a person?

Probably Animal.
